The Opportunity

As part of the Risk & Governance Division's team your position involves supporting the evolution and delivery of the second line Risk and Assurance functions of La Trobe Financial. In particular, the position is focused on:

  • assisting the management, embedding and operation of the Risk Management Framework; and
  • supporting the delivery of key risk initiatives and maturation of our risk, control and compliance frameworks.

In this role, working closely with the Manager, Operational Risk and the Head of Risk and Compliance, you will engage collaboratively with employees across all divisions of La Trobe Financial. Coupled with your prior experience in a related risk role, you are required to work exceptionally well with people and utilise your excellent interpersonal communication, problem solving and analytical skills, out of box thinking whilst maintaining a curious and positive mindset to help deliver on the above position objectives.

Key Responsibilities

The responsibilities of the Risk Analyst include, but are not limited to:

Strategic:

  • Support the embedding of policies, frameworks, systems and processes to support continuous improvement in the Group's approach and adoption of best practice in Enterprise Risk Management and Compliance.

Operational:

  • Provide support in conducting the half yearly and annual review of Business Division's risk profile, including ensuring the risks and controls register is always updated in Protecht.
  • Provide support to the ongoing update and maintenance of Protecht (La Trobe's Enterprise Risk Management system) in recording and managing risk related matters, including engaging with Protecht system support to meet.
  • Provide support to the Business Divisions by way of risk related training, and Protecht system training around its usage and functionalities to help embed the use of the system in day-to-day management and reporting of risks.
  • Provide support to the enhancement and implementation of a control assurance framework
  • Provide support to strengthening of our Third Party Risk Management Framework, ensuring we have appropriate on-boarding, off-boarding and risk assessment completed and captured utilising Protecht.
  • Provide support to enhance our Model Risk Framework ensuring we have processes and tools to identify, assess, manage and validate our model inventory.
  • Provide support in managing and closing internal or external audit or assurance review findings
  • Provide support in deep dives, investigation and remediation of any operational risk incidents reported to the risk team
  • Provide support for any implementation of other key risk initiatives furthering the embedding of our Risk Management Framework and Compliance Management Framework within the organisation.

Reporting/Governance:

  • Provide support to deliver risk reporting to management and board risk committees, including quarterly key risk indicator reporting, and outcomes of half year and full year risk review activities, working closely with divisional risk champions.
  • Provide support to deliver required reviews and refresh of the Group Risk Management Framework and Group Risk Appetite Statement.
